The Role of Magnesium in Muscle Function
Magnesium is the fourth most abundant mineral in the human body, playing a critical role in over 300 biochemical reactions. Within muscles, its function is paramount, acting as a natural calcium channel blocker to regulate nerve impulses that control muscle contraction and relaxation. When the body has sufficient magnesium, muscles contract and relax smoothly. However, a deficiency, or hypomagnesemia, can lead to increased neuromuscular excitability, resulting in the involuntary and often painful spasms we know as muscle cramps.
Magnesium deficiency can stem from various causes, including poor dietary intake, increased losses due to illness or medication, or intense exercise. While supplementation is a common approach to correcting a deficiency, the specific form of magnesium significantly impacts its effectiveness. Factors such as absorption rate and potential side effects vary widely between different types of magnesium supplements.
Why Absorption Matters for Cramp Relief
The body’s ability to absorb magnesium from a supplement is known as its bioavailability. Forms with higher bioavailability mean more of the mineral reaches the bloodstream and, consequently, the muscle tissues where it is needed. Low-bioavailability forms, like magnesium oxide, often cause gastrointestinal issues because much of the unabsorbed mineral remains in the gut. For maximum therapeutic effect, especially for persistent issues like muscle cramps, a highly bioavailable form is preferred.
Popular Magnesium Forms for Muscle Cramps
Several forms of magnesium are marketed for muscle-related issues, but their properties differ based on what the magnesium is bound to.
Magnesium Glycinate (or Bisglycinate)
This form is chelated, meaning magnesium is bound to the amino acid glycine. This creates a highly absorbable supplement that is notably gentle on the digestive system and less likely to cause diarrhea than other forms. Glycine is also known for its calming properties, which can aid in muscle relaxation and improve sleep quality, making magnesium glycinate an excellent choice for relieving nighttime muscle cramps.
Magnesium Citrate
Magnesium citrate is magnesium bound to citric acid. It is one of the most common and relatively well-absorbed forms. Due to its osmotic effect in the bowel, it also acts as a laxative. This can be a beneficial side effect for individuals dealing with constipation but may be undesirable for others seeking only muscle relief. It is a popular and cost-effective choice for general magnesium supplementation.
Magnesium Malate
This form binds magnesium with malic acid, a compound found in fruits like apples. Because malic acid is involved in energy production, magnesium malate is often recommended for individuals with muscle fatigue or soreness. Some studies suggest it may help reduce muscle tenderness associated with conditions like fibromyalgia.
Other Forms (Magnesium Oxide, Sulfate)
- Magnesium Oxide: This is a cheap, widely available form with very poor absorption rates (as low as 4%). It is primarily used as a laxative and is not effective for correcting a magnesium deficiency or treating cramps. Studies show it is no better than a placebo for nocturnal leg cramps.
- Magnesium Sulfate (Epsom Salt): This is typically used externally in baths. While it promotes relaxation, the amount of magnesium absorbed through the skin is likely minimal and its effectiveness for deep muscle cramps is limited.
Comparison of Magnesium Forms for Muscle Cramp Relief
To help you decide, here is a comparison of the most relevant magnesium forms for addressing muscle cramps, based on their properties and user experiences.
| Magnesium Form | Bioavailability | Digestive Impact | Primary Benefit for Cramps | Best For |
|---|---|---|---|---|
| Glycinate | High | Gentle, minimal risk of diarrhea | Muscle relaxation, sleep support | Individuals seeking cramp relief with sensitive stomachs or those who need sleep support. |
| Citrate | Good | Mild to strong laxative effect | Muscle relaxation and tension reduction | People with occasional constipation who also want cramp relief. |
| Malate | Good | Gentle on the stomach | Energy production, muscle pain/soreness | Active individuals or those with muscle fatigue in addition to cramps. |
| Oxide | Poor | High laxative effect | Laxative action, not effective for cramps | Not recommended for muscle cramp relief. |
A Holistic Approach to Preventing Muscle Cramps
While magnesium supplementation is helpful, particularly for those with a confirmed deficiency, it is part of a larger strategy for preventing muscle cramps. Hydration, proper nutrition, and targeted stretching are equally vital.
Here are some best practices for managing and preventing cramps:
- Stay Hydrated: Dehydration is a major cause of muscle cramps. Ensure you are drinking enough water throughout the day, especially if you exercise or are in hot weather.
- Maintain Electrolyte Balance: Electrolytes like potassium, sodium, and calcium also play key roles in muscle function. A balanced diet rich in fruits and vegetables helps maintain these levels.
- Stretch Regularly: Regular stretching, especially before bed or after exercise, can help prevent cramps. Stretching the affected muscle during a cramp can also provide immediate relief.
Dietary Sources of Magnesium
Increasing your dietary magnesium intake is an excellent first step. Some of the best food sources include:
- Leafy greens (spinach, Swiss chard)
- Nuts (almonds, cashews)
- Seeds (pumpkin, chia)
- Legumes (black beans, chickpeas)
- Whole grains (oatmeal, brown rice)
- Avocados
- Dark chocolate
Conclusion: Which Magnesium is Best for Muscle Cramps?
For those experiencing muscle cramps, magnesium glycinate stands out due to its high bioavailability and minimal gastrointestinal side effects. Its calming properties are a bonus, especially for nighttime cramps. Magnesium citrate is another viable option, offering good absorption, but its laxative effect should be considered. Magnesium malate is a good alternative for those with muscle fatigue. Conversely, lower bioavailability forms like magnesium oxide are ineffective for cramp relief.
